Determinants of arterial properties in Chinese type-2 diabetic patients compared with population-based controls.

Abstract

OBJECTIVE

To our knowledge, few studies compared the association of brachial-ankle pulse wave velocity (baPWV) with cardiovascular risk factors among Chinese with type-2 diabetes mellitus and non-diabetic controls. This study addresses this issue.

METHODS

We measured baPWV (OMRON VP1000) in 413 diabetic patients from Shanghai city (mean age: 58.7 years; 57% women) and 354 controls randomly recruited from the population of JingNing county, Zhejiang Province. We used stepwise multiple regression to identify covariables of baPWV and introduced interaction terms in the models to compare slopes. We expressed association sizes for continuous variables for a 1-SD increase in the dependent variable.

RESULTS

Adjusted baPWV was higher in diabetic patients than controls (1678 vs 1583 cm/sec; P= 0.018). In diabetic patients, baPWV was independently correlated with female sex (-61 cm/sec; P = 0.061), age (+107 cm/sec; P < 0.0001), height (-51 cm/sec; P = 0.012), systolic pressure (+99 cm/sec; P < 0.0001), and the HDL-to-total cholesterol ratio (-38 cm/sec; P = 0.0004). In controls, the explanatory variables were female sex (-74 cm/sec; P = 0.045), age (+138 cm/sec; P < 0.0001), height (-262 cm/sec; P < 0.0001), systolic pressure (+202 cm/sec; P < 0.0001), but not the HDL-to-total cholesterol ratio (P = 0.48). Explained variance of baPWV was 34% and 61% in diabetic patients and controls, respectively. The associations of baPWV with age, height and systolic pressure were steeper (P < 0.04) in controls than diabetic patients.

CONCLUSION

Sex, age, height and systolic pressure were the main determinants of baPWV in Chinese, irrespective of whether they had diabetes or not, but these associations were tighter in population-based controls without diabetes.

摘要

目的

据我们所知,很少有研究比较中国2型糖尿病患者与非糖尿病对照者中肱踝脉搏波速度(baPWV)与心血管危险因素之间的关联。本研究旨在解决这一问题。

方法

我们对来自上海市的413例糖尿病患者(平均年龄:58.7岁;57%为女性)和从浙江省景宁县人群中随机招募的354例对照者测量了baPWV(欧姆龙VP1000)。我们使用逐步多元回归来确定baPWV的协变量,并在模型中引入交互项以比较斜率。我们以因变量增加1个标准差来表示连续变量的关联大小。

结果

糖尿病患者的校正baPWV高于对照组(1678 vs 1583 cm/秒;P = 0.018)。在糖尿病患者中,baPWV与女性性别(-61 cm/秒;P = 0.061)、年龄(+107 cm/秒;P < 0.0001)、身高(-51 cm/秒;P = 0.012)、收缩压(+99 cm/秒;P < 0.0001)以及高密度脂蛋白与总胆固醇比值(-38 cm/秒;P = 0.0004)独立相关。在对照组中,解释变量为女性性别(-74 cm/秒;P = 0.045)、年龄(+138 cm/秒;P < 0.0001)、身高(-262 cm/秒;P < 0.0001)、收缩压(+202 cm/秒;P < 0.0001),但与高密度脂蛋白与总胆固醇比值无关(P = 0.48)。在糖尿病患者和对照组中,baPWV的解释方差分别为34%和61%。对照组中baPWV与年龄、身高和收缩压的关联比糖尿病患者更显著(P < 0.04)。

结论

性别、年龄、身高和收缩压是中国人baPWV的主要决定因素,无论其是否患有糖尿病,但这些关联在无糖尿病的人群对照中更为紧密。
